Understanding Sweden Driving License Fees: A Complete Guide
Obtaining a driving license in Sweden represents a considerable milestone for both new drivers and citizens relocating from abroad. The Swedish driving license system is renowned for its thoroughness and focus on safety, which naturally influences the associated costs. Comprehending the total fee structure assists prospective drivers budget properly and prevent unexpected expenditures throughout the licensing process. This comprehensive guide takes a look at every element of Sweden driving license costs, from initial application to last issuance, supplying readers with the in-depth info needed to browse this vital administrative process.
The Swedish Driving License System Overview
Sweden maintains among the most extensive chauffeur education systems in Europe, reflecting the nation's dedication to roadway security and accountable driving. The system needs aspiring drivers to complete both theoretical and useful training before they can sit for the last evaluation. Unlike some nations where a simple written test is enough, Sweden mandates structured expert direction, making the procedure more costly but ultimately producing highly proficient drivers.
The Swedish Transport Administration, called Transportstyrelsen, manages the licensing system and establishes the fees associated with applications, evaluations, and license issuance. These costs stay constant throughout the country, though the total cost to obtain a license varies considerably depending on individual situations, geographical location, and the number of driving lessons required. Typically, Swedish residents ought to expect overall costs varying from 5,000 to 15,000 Swedish krona (SEK), though some individuals may spend more or less based upon their knowing speed and natural aptitude for driving.
Driving License Categories and Associated Base Fees
The Swedish licensing system divides automobile into several distinct categories, each carrying its own charge structure. Comprehending these classifications helps candidates pick the proper license type for their intended lorry use and matching budget.
| License Category | Description | Base Application Fee | Examination Fee | License Issuance Fee |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Category B | Guest automobiles and light vans (approximately 3,500 kg) | 250 SEK | 325 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Category A1 | Light bikes (as much as 125cc) | 250 SEK | 300 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Category A | Requirement motorbikes | 250 SEK | 350 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Classification BE | B towing trailers over 750 kg | 250 SEK | 350 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Classification C1 | Medium trucks (3,500-7,500 kg) | 250 SEK | 375 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Classification C | Heavy trucks (over 7,500 kg) | 250 SEK | 400 SEK | 280 SEK |
| Classification D1 | Small buses (up to 16 guests) | 250 SEK | 400 SEK | 280 SEK |
The base application cost stays uniform across all categories at 250 SEK, covering the administrative processing of the application and confirmation of eligibility requirements such as identity verification and prerequisite conclusion.
Breakdown of Training and Education Costs
Beyond the government-mandated costs, the most substantial part of Sweden driving license fees comes from the compulsory professional driver education. Swedish law needs all license candidates to finish courses with certified driving trainers, guaranteeing standardized quality throughout all training programs.
Obligatory Theoretical Education
Before attempting any practical driving, applicants need to complete danger education courses attending to alcohol awareness, tiredness prevention, and overall danger recognition. This theoretical component normally costs between 800 and 1,500 SEK depending on the driving school and region. The courses typically cover 2 days and include both class guideline and practical demonstrations, supplying important knowledge that forms the foundation of safe driving practices.
Practical Driving Lessons
The variety of mandatory driving lessons varies based upon the license category and specific progress, though policies specify minimum requirements. For a basic Category B license, applicants need to finish at least 15 hours of useful driving instruction distributed throughout various ability locations including city driving, Hur Man FåR Svenskt KöRkort rural roads, highways, and nighttime conditions. The typical cost per lesson ranges from 450 to 700 SEK across Swedish driving schools, with costs usually higher in cities such as Stockholm, Gothenburg, and Malmö.
| Training Component | Minimum Required | Average Cost Range | Common Total Cost |
|---|---|---|---|
| Risk Education (Part 1) | 4 hours | 400-700 SEK | 400-700 SEK |
| Threat Education (Part 2) | 4 hours | 400-700 SEK | 400-700 SEK |
| City Driving Lessons | 4 hours | 450-700 SEK per lesson | 1,800-2,800 SEK |
| Rural & & Highway Driving | 4 hours | 450-700 SEK per lesson | 1,800-2,800 SEK |
| Night Driving | 3 hours | 450-700 SEK per lesson | 1,350-2,100 SEK |
| Maneuvering & & Parking | 2 hours | 450-700 SEK per lesson | 900-1,400 SEK |
Extra lessons beyond the mandatory minimum regularly show needed, especially for candidates who need more practice time to accomplish examination preparedness. Many Swedish driving schools use bundle deals that provide more economical rates than individual lesson purchases, with comprehensive packages varying from 8,000 to 12,000 SEK for complete Category B training programs.
Examination Costs and Potential Resit Fees
The theoretical and practical examinations performed by Transportstyrelsen constitute vital turning points in the licensing procedure, each bring its own cost structure that applicants should represent in their budgeting.
The driving license theory test costs 325 SEK and evaluates the applicant's understanding of traffic policies, road signs, vehicle operation, and hazard perception. This computer-based assessment utilizes visual stimuli and multiple-choice concerns to determine readiness for useful driving. Candidates who do not hand down their very first attempt needs to pay the evaluation charge again for each subsequent attempt, making comprehensive preparation financially beneficial.

Additional Expenses to Consider
A number of ancillary expenses add to the overall cost of acquiring a Swedish driving license beyond the main costs and training expenses. Eye examinations are compulsory before starting motorist education, with basic testing offered at a lot of opticians for around 150-300 SEK. Medical certificates might be required for specific license categories or candidates with particular health conditions, adding another 200-500 SEK to the overall cost.
Driving school registration and membership fees, varying from 200 to 500 SEK, offer access to curriculum products, online practice tests, and scheduling systems. Lots of schools also charge for the mandatory introduction course, which familiarizes applicants with basic automobile controls and treatments before formal lessons start, generally costing 300-500 SEK.

Often Asked Questions
How long does it usually take to acquire a Swedish driving license, and does period impact overall expenses?
The timeline for obtaining a Swedish driving license differs considerably based on specific scenarios, though the procedure normally spans three to 6 months from preliminary application to license issuance. Candidates who advance quickly through training and pass examinations on their first efforts sustain lower costs, while those needing additional lessons or repeated examinations face escalating expenses. Reserving dedicated time for concentrated learning and maintaining consistent practice schedules often proves more cost-effective than extended timelines with sporadic lessons.
Are there any financial assistance programs available to help offset Sweden driving license charges?
A number of towns and counties in Sweden offer reduced-cost or subsidized chauffeur education programs for young homeowners, especially those aged 18-25. Regional education authorities might offer financial backing through numerous youth programs, and specific joblessness offices fund chauffeur training as a path to employment. Furthermore, some driving schools provide installment payment strategies and versatile funding options to assist households handle the upfront costs of chauffeur education.
What takes place if I stop working the driving assessment? What are the costs for retaking it?
Candidates who do not pass either the theoretical or useful assessment must wait a minimum of one week before retaking the evaluation and must pay the full evaluation charge again for each effort. The waiting duration permits candidates time for additional practice and preparation, which Transportstyrelsen advises to avoid accumulating unnecessary resit expenses. While a lot of candidates hand down their second or 3rd attempt, some individuals need multiple retakes, making extensive preparation essential for both passing and expense management.

Is the cost of a Swedish driving license tax-deductible in any scenarios?
While individual driving license expenses are generally not tax-deductible for Swedish taxpayers, certain expert driving licenses might qualify as overhead. Individuals pursuing driving as an occupation or those whose employment particularly needs a Swedish license should talk to a tax consultant regarding potential deductions. Furthermore, some companies partly compensate worker driving license expenses as a benefit, especially for positions requiring regular automobile usage.
What payment methods do driving schools and Transportstyrelsen accept for license costs?
Transportstyrelsen accepts payment for government charges through bank transfers, online payment systems, and particular debit and charge card, with specific payment options varying by service channel. Driving schools generally accept money payments, bank transfers, and major credit and debit cards, with lots of offering online payment websites for convenience. Bundle deals and course fees generally need payment in advance of training beginning, while specific lesson payments may be made sequentially.
